When the Korean national football team's 'ace' Heung-Min Son collapsed from an injury, fans poured criticism on Marseille's Chancel Mbemba, who collided with him.



Heung-Min Son, Marseille (France) and Marseille (France) on the 2nd (local time) and during the final 6th match of the 2022-2023 UEFA Champions League (UCL) group stage match for an aerial ball, hit Mbemba's shoulder with a strong left face and collapsed. He was substituted in the 29th minute of the first half.



Afterwards, Tottenham Hotspur announced that Son Heung-min was scheduled to undergo surgery for an orbital fracture.



It is currently unknown whether Son Heung-min will be able to play the 2022 Qatar World Cup, which starts on the 20th, normally.



After the match between the two teams, fans angry at Son Heung-min's injury responded to Mbemba's social networking service (SNS).



His recent posts were followed by criticism and abusive language using Korean and English, various emoticons, and racist comments appeared.



Some fans instead apologized for some fans' outrageous behavior.



An Instagram user who identified himself as Korean said, "I have a different opinion from those who criticize you. It was a common occurrence in soccer."



Mbemba and Heung-Min Son also had a bad relationship in the first round of the UCL group stage in September.



Heung-Min Son, who was breaking into the penalty area after receiving a pass from Harry Kane in the second minute, stumbled over Mbemba's tackle and induced his red card.



Then, in the second meeting, which took place in about two months, Son Heung-min took on an unexpected injury.
